Facebook still reign supreme as the world’s biggest social media website. However, there has been a growing demand for more mobile options in sharing videos and pictures, with apps such as Instagram, becoming a popular alternative.

Instagram was first introduced over 3 years ago and has been a viral sensation. Users from around the world have used the application on their PC and their phones to the tune of over 80 million users. With each day, their number of Instagram users is steadily increasing, and it is expected soon to pass the 100 million mark. Their growing popularity motivated Facebook to acquire the company quickly.

To get a better field of Instagram, here is the 411 on Instagram:

• The app began in 2010 for users with an iPhone. As the amount of users increased from 1 million, they decided to expand to other platforms.

• The growth rate was higher than other social networking sites such as Twitter in half the time.

• Over 20 billion photos have been taken and shared across the globe. On Instagram on an average day over 55 million pics are shared by users.

• In 2012, Facebook acquired Instagram for $1 billion in stock and cash.

• Major companies have taken to use Instagram in order to promote or advertise their products.

• The application is available on Windows Phone OS, Android 2.2 and higher, as well as iOS 6 and higher.

• For Symbian OS and Blackberry OS devices, Instagram is available with third-party applications

• The popular application is increasing in usage as ages 12 to 20 claim to prefer Instagram over Twitter and Facebook by 23 percent.

• Apple in 2011 named Instagram the “App of the Year.”
